It is extremely important that my children start out their days right. Whether they are at school learning, working on a craft at home, or spending time with friends during a play-date, I want them to be happy, full of energy, and ready to engage the day.

Thanks to Silk Fruit & Protein and Socialmoms, Mom Bloggers like myself were asked to share “Shake Up Your Wake Up” Morning Routine Tips. I thought this would be a great opportunity to share 5 Ways To Make Waking Up Great For Your Children!

First, allow children time to wake-up.  This gives them a few minutes to get moving around. Waking them up at the very last-minute makes everyone feel rushed and starts the day off on a bad note. Plus, they could miss out on a balanced breakfast, and they need this to fuel their day. Personally, if I ever feel short on time, I have my kids get dressed before they come to the breakfast table.

Second, discuss the fun things they will be doing during the day. This way, you know what is going on, and the kids get excited.  FYI,  I try not to discuss hot topics first thing in the morning.  Unless it is a matter of safety, most big discussions can wait till later in the day or after school. There is no reason to send children to school upset, this could lead to misbehavior.

Fourth, take the time to sit with them while they eat breakfast. I am terrible at this in the morning, but I want to get better at it. There is something special about a family eating together.  This can also be the time that parents can discuss the events that will be occurring during the day.

Finally, take a moment to tell your children that you love them, and send them off with well wishes for the day.  If your kids will let you, give them a hug or kiss before they go into school. I say, “I hope you have a great day!” and try to grab mine for a hug and a kiss before we leave the house.
